Maximize Your Cloud Budget: Understanding AWS Database Savings Plans

In today’s rapidly evolving cloud landscape, optimizing cloud expenses is essential for businesses leveraging AWS services. One effective way to do this is through AWS Database Savings Plans. This guide will delve into everything you need to know about AWS Database Savings Plans, focusing on their features, benefits, and integration with Amazon OpenSearch Service and Amazon Neptune Analytics.

Table of Contents

  1. Introduction
  2. What Are AWS Database Savings Plans?
  3. Key Features of Database Savings Plans
  4. Eligibility and Coverage
  5. How to Get Started with Database Savings Plans
  6. Understanding Amazon OpenSearch Service
  7. 6.1 What is Amazon OpenSearch?
  8. 6.2 Integrating Database Savings Plans with OpenSearch
  9. Understanding Amazon Neptune Analytics
  10. 7.1 What is Amazon Neptune?
  11. 7.2 Integrating Database Savings Plans with Neptune Analytics
  12. Cost Savings Calculations
  13. Best Practices for Utilizing Database Savings Plans
  14. Future of AWS Database Services
  15. Conclusion

Introduction

AWS continually innovates to help businesses save money while accessing powerful cloud computing capabilities. The latest offering, Database Savings Plans, supports services like Amazon OpenSearch Service and Amazon Neptune Analytics, allowing organizations to optimize their database usage costs effectively.

In this comprehensive guide, we will discuss how to leverage AWS Database Savings Plans to reduce your cloud expenditures while maintaining flexibility and scalability in your database solutions.

What Are AWS Database Savings Plans?

AWS Database Savings Plans are flexible pricing models designed to provide significant savings on eligible database usage in exchange for a commitment to a consistent usage amount over a one-year term. Here’s what makes them unique:

  • Savings of up to 35%: By committing to a specific usage amount, you can unlock substantial cost savings compared to on-demand pricing.
  • No upfront payment required: Customers can start realizing savings without the need for large upfront investments.
  • Flexibility: Database Savings Plans apply to both serverless and provisioned database instances across various AWS database services, making it easier to manage costs.

Benefits of Database Savings Plans

  1. Cost Efficiency: Companies can save a significant amount on their AWS bills through a commitment to regular usage.
  2. Flexibility Across Services: The plans cover several database services, providing users the opportunity to switch engines or instance types without losing savings.
  3. Easy Management: AWS Billing and Cost Management Console simplifies tracking and managing your commitments.

Key Features of Database Savings Plans

Understanding the features of Database Savings Plans is crucial for anyone looking to manage their AWS database costs effectively. Key features include:

  1. Universal Application: Covers various services without being tied to instance families or sizes.
  2. Automatic Application: Discounts automatically apply to eligible resources, ensuring you always benefit from savings.
  3. Simple Purchase Process: You can effortlessly get started with these plans through the AWS Management Console or AWS CLI.

Eligibility and Coverage

Not all database services are eligible for Database Savings Plans. Here’s an overview of what you can expect:

  • Eligible Services:
  • Amazon OpenSearch Service
  • Amazon Neptune Analytics
  • Other supported AWS database services

  • Global Availability: The savings plans are available in all AWS regions, with the exception of the China regions.

  • Usage Requirements: The plans measure usage in $/hour, meaning organizations can commit to different levels of usage based on their anticipated workload.


How to Get Started with Database Savings Plans

Step 1: Analyze Your Database Usage

Before committing to a Database Savings Plan, it’s crucial to assess your current usage. Use AWS’s management tools:

  • AWS Cost Explorer: Provides insights on your spending patterns and forecasts future costs based on historical usage.
  • AWS Budgets: Allows you to create budgets, track your spending, and receive alerts when you exceed budgeted thresholds.

Step 2: Review Purchase Recommendations

The AWS Billing and Cost Management Console will provide recommendations based on your usage patterns. This will help you make an informed decision on how much to commit.

Step 3: Make Your Commitment

Select the amount you wish to commit to and complete the purchase via the AWS console or CLI. Remember, it’s crucial to base your commitment on thorough analysis to optimize cost savings.


Understanding Amazon OpenSearch Service

What is Amazon OpenSearch?

Amazon OpenSearch Service is a scalable, secure, and cost-effective search and analytics solution. It allows users to search, analyze, and visualize data in real time, a critical requirement for many modern applications.

Integrating Database Savings Plans with OpenSearch

With Database Savings Plans, users can switch instance types within OpenSearch without losing discounts, allowing flexibility in scaling computing resources as needed.

  • Example Use Case: A business could start with an instance type like m7i.large.search and switch to c8g.2xlarge.search as demand grows, all while continuously benefiting from cost savings.

Understanding Amazon Neptune Analytics

What is Amazon Neptune?

Amazon Neptune is a fully managed graph database service that supports both the Property Graph model and the RDF model, enabling users to build applications that can process huge amounts of data relationships.

Integrating Database Savings Plans with Neptune Analytics

Database Savings Plans provide Neptune users with flexible savings. As your analytics workloads grow, you can easily change instance types or scale up your resources without losing your savings.

  • Typical Scenarios: Scaling out a Neptune database for complex queries or analytical tasks typically requires significant compute resources. Thanks to Database Savings Plans, users can save money while doing so.

Cost Savings Calculations

To maximize your savings with AWS Database Savings Plans, understanding cost calculations is pivotal:

  1. Base Rate Analysis: Start with your current on-demand rates to understand how much you’re currently spending.
  2. Savings Comparison: Compare these costs with potential costs using Database Savings Plans for similar workloads.
  3. Long-Term Forecasting: Utilize cost forecasting tools within AWS to estimate performance over time based on expected usage patterns.

Example Cost Calculation

  • On-demand usage cost for a month: $1000
  • Savings Plan discount applied (30%): $700 post-discount
  • Total savings for the year: $3,600

Utilizing calculators provided by AWS can help refine these estimates further.


Best Practices for Utilizing Database Savings Plans

To ensure that you get the most out of Database Savings Plans, consider the following best practices:

  1. Regular Monitoring: Continuously analyze your database usage and adjust commitments as necessary.
  2. Informed Decision Making: Use AWS tools to assess which instances and usage patterns lead to the highest savings.
  3. Break Down Costs By Team: For larger organizations, tracking database usage and associated costs across teams can provide better insights and optimize spending.

Key Tools for Management

  • AWS Cost Explorer: Visualize and analyze your usage and spending trends over time.
  • AWS Budgets: Help you manage costs and usage by setting thresholds for expenses.

Future of AWS Database Services

As cloud technology continues to evolve, the future looks bright for AWS database services. Key trends to watch include:

  • Increased Performance and Scalability: AWS continuously enhances its offerings to provide better performance and cost efficiency.
  • Artificial Intelligence Integration: AI and machine learning capabilities in database services are expected to grow, allowing for advanced analytics and predictive modeling.
  • Greater Flexibility in Pricing Models: As competition increases, AWS will likely continue to innovate in pricing strategies to help organizations manage costs effectively.

Conclusion

AWS Database Savings Plans offer an incredible opportunity for businesses looking to optimize their database expenses seamlessly. By understanding how these plans work, their benefits, and how they integrate with services like Amazon OpenSearch Service and Amazon Neptune Analytics, you can make informed decisions that lead to substantial savings.

Remember to regularly assess your database usage and make adjustments as needed to ensure you continue maximizing your cost reductions.

Get started with AWS Database Savings Plans today — a smart investment for your cloud infrastructure.


This guide has provided comprehensive insights on AWS Database Savings Plans, including how to leverage them effectively in your organization. By utilizing these plans, your business can enjoy significant cost savings on AWS database services.

Final focus keyphrase: AWS Database Savings Plans now supports Amazon OpenSearch Service and Amazon Neptune Analytics.

Learn more

More on Stackpioneers

Other Tutorials